At no more than 1500 watts PEP output is there any great justification to
run two parallel GS-35B's rather than one?

What I was thinking was that two tubes with a 100 watt exciter would be
mostly damage proof from "operator" errors and have lots of headroom. But
two tubes run the initial cost up somewhat and there could be a problem with
balance between the tubes not to mention the blower size doubling.

Or is one GS-35B already hard to damage at US power limits?
